Fashion Design,Intermediate

UPDATED 20150731 09:36:50

This course provides the opportunity to learn about and develop your pattern cutting and sewing techniques,including dyeing and fabric surface manipulation. You will produce fabric samples and finished surface samples as part of the course,which is designed as a natural progression from the Introduction to Fashion Design. You will work with highly qualified staff,who have extensive professional experience,within state - of - the - art facilities. You will produce a portfolio of work that you could present at an interview for a full - time or part - time course in art and design.
